Ziaul Haq Amarkhel, former governor of Nangarhar province, condemned Pakistan’s attack on Kabul city last night, calling it a clear violation of Afghanistan’s territorial integrity.

He stated that only two countries in the world commit such blatant aggression, with Israel being one and Pakistan the other.


Amarkhel emphasized that “the entire nation should unite against Pakistan.

This country has worked for decades to destroy and weaken systems in Afghanistan.” He also called on the international community not to remain silent about Pakistan’s aggression and to show a clear response to such violations.


The former governor’s statement highlights growing criticism among Afghan officials regarding Pakistan’s recent aerial strikes on Afghan soil.

His comparison of Pakistan’s actions to those of Israel underscores the severity with which he views these cross-border attacks on Afghan territory.
